Reprogramming

If your remote with a keyless lock has stopped working or was damaged, you may need to get your vehicle changed. A locksmith car keys near me can provide this service since they have a range of tools to assist in completing the task. This includes key analyzers as well as VATS passcode detectors, and a mechanical key cutter.

The reprogramming process is dependent on the make and model of your car. In certain instances you'll need access to the onboard computer of your car for this process. Your locksmith, for instance will connect their computer with the OBD port (onboard diagnostics port) of your vehicle. This is usually located beneath the dashboard. Once connected to the port, the locksmith will have access to software that controls electronic locks and keyfobs within your vehicle.

Before you get your car reprogrammed, make sure you shut all doors and then put the key in the ignition. You'll require the key fob to be inserted, then you'll need to push the lock button a few more times.

You can also ask the dealer reprogram your vehicle. Locksmiths can handle the job for you faster and at a lower cost.

Up until the 21st century, a majority of keys to cars were metal pieces with grooves that corresponded to certain internal components of the ignition cylinder. Today, the process is much more complex. Today, most cars don't use keys anymore, instead they use electronic chips that communicate with the car's system to start it.

This is a great method to increase security, but it can be a pain if you lose or damage your key. Call your local locksmith to re-programme your vehicle when you are in this situation. They have the necessary equipment and expertise to complete the job efficiently and without causing additional damage to your vehicle. They'll also be able to provide you with an alternative key fob if you require it. This will ensure that your key works every time and doesn't accidentally disengage the immobilizer, which is a security feature that is built into the majority of modern automobiles.

Duplicate Keys

Having your keys duplicated means you'll have an extra key in case one gets damaged or lost. This is a great option when you don't want spend the money for an entirely new car key or key fob from the dealership. It's much more convenient than calling roadside assistance to get a replacement car key.

You can purchase an alternative key from an auto dealer or auto locksmith. It is important to note that the key you purchase may not work with your car. Modern cars are equipped with transponders to prevent theft. To start your vehicle and start your car, the chip on your car's key must match the transceiver's coding. Contacting a Queen Creek mobile locksmith car auto lockout is the best way to ensure that your duplicate key works with your vehicle.

Most people think that getting a new car key or key fob is as easy as going to their local hardware store and using a machine to cut and grind out the key made of metal. This is certainly true for older cars, but most modern vehicles come with keyfobs that need specialized programming in order to unlock and start their engines. This is something that only a skilled, professional locksmith can handle.

A locksmith for autos will also provide a guarantee or warranty on the fob or key they design for your vehicle. This provides peace of mind and an idea that your money was well spent on an auto locksmith.

Audi.jpgKey duplication is generally less expensive than purchasing a new key. The latter is more difficult to manufacture and takes more time. Locksmith services will be able to give you a more affordable cost if you provide them with proof that you are the owner of the vehicle, such as the registration, title or purchase paperwork.
